Tesla world wide sales analysis

Discussion in 'Tesla' started by bwilson4web, Jul 19, 2019.

  1. bwilson4web

    bwilson4web Well-Known Member Subscriber





    Bob Wilson
     
    Last edited: Jul 19, 2019

Share This Page